How much does it cost to rent a home in West Little River?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
West Little River 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,373 | $1,925 | $3,000 |
West Little River 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,117 | $2,650 | $3,800 |
West Little River 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,487 | $2,810 | $4,375 |

Frequently Asked Questions about West Little River
What type of rentals are currently available in West Little River?
There are currently 150 Apartments for Rent in West Little River, FL with pricing that ranges from $1,005 to $4,000. There are also 48 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in West Little River ranging from $850 to $4,375.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in West Little River?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in West Little River ranges from $850 to $4,375 with an average monthly rent of $2,339.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in West Little River?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in West Little River range from $1,383 to $4,000,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$2,650 to $3,800.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,810 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$3,800.
